Common Types of Mold and Their Characteristics

While diverse beyond measure, a few types of mold are often identified in indoor environments, presenting various visual characteristics and potential impacts:

  • Cladosporium: A very prevalent mold, usually appearing as black, brown, or green velvety patches. It is frequently found on painted surfaces, wood, and within he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) systems. Cladosporium is a well-known allergen, often exacerbating asthma and allergy symptoms.
  • Penicillium: Identifiable by its hairy, blue-green appearance, often colonizing water-damaged materials, rotted food, and insulation. Certain Penicillium species are well-known producers of various mycotoxins.
  • Aspergillus: A widespread indoor mold with diverse appearances (varying colors and textures). Some Aspergillus species are significant allergens, while others can emit mycotoxins. It typically thrives in water-damaged buildings.
  • Alternaria: Frequently found as deep velvety spots, this mold is a frequent allergen. It tends to grow best in damp areas like washrooms or food prep spaces.
  • Stachybotrys chartarum (Black Mold): This species is arguably the most well-known, often dubbed “black mold.” It presents as a greasy, greenish-black substance and typically grows on cellulose-rich materials (like drywall, decorative paper, or wood) that have been consistently wet for extended periods. Stachybotrys chartarum is highly concerning because it can emit potent mycotoxins, toxic compounds that can have severe negative health effects. Health and Property Risks

Why is Mold Dangerous?

Exposure to mold, particularly in Munford, Tennessee’s susceptible environment, carries a diverse of harmful health effects, influenced by an individual’s sensitivity, the specific mold species, and the intensity of exposure. Beyond health, mold poses major threats to the building and visual integrity of your property.

  • Allergic Reactions: Common symptoms include sneezing, chronic runny nose, itchy or red eyes, dermatitis, and skin inflammation.
  • Respiratory Issues: Mold can initiate or worsen asthma attacks, result in persistent coughing, difficulty breathing, shortness of breath, and chest tightness. Chronic exposure has been connected to severe respiratory conditions like chronic lung issues.
  • Irritation: Bloodshot of the eyes, generalized skin irritation, and throat discomfort are frequently reported.
  • Mycotoxin Effects: Certain molds (like Stachybotrys chartarum) produce mycotoxins that, when absorbed, can lead to more intense and systemic symptoms including chronic fatigue, frequent headaches, memory issues (“mental cloudiness”), vertigo, nausea, and various forms of weakened immunity.

Vulnerable populations, including young children, the elderly, individuals with chronic respiratory conditions, allergies, asthma, or suppressed immune systems, are particularly susceptible to mold’s negative consequences.

  • Structural Deterioration: Mold actively digests organic materials (lumber, plasterboard, plaster), weakening structures over time. This can compromise walls, flooring, and even foundation, leading to highly costly and extensive repairs.
  • Persistent Odors: Mold infestations emit a characteristic earthy, stale odor that can permeate carpets, upholstery, furniture, and all soft furnishings, making the indoor environment unpleasant and challenging to get rid of.
  • Aesthetic Degradation: Visible mold stains and discoloration on surfaces (walls, ceilings, upholstery) decrease the property’s appearance and significantly diminish its market value.
  • Conducive to Pests: Damp, moldy conditions attract various pests, introducing additional complications and requiring further intervention.
Clearing the Air

Mold Myths Debunked

It’s important to distinguish common misunderstandings from scientific evidence to accurately address mold challenges:

  • Myth: Bleach Kills All Mold Effectively. Fact: While bleach can temporarily kill mold on non-porous surfaces, it is often inefficient on porous materials, where mold hyphae penetrate deeply. Bleach can also damage materials, release irritating fumes, and its effectiveness is compromised by the presence of organic material that mold feeds on. EPA-registered, mold killers are far more effective and safer.
  • Myth: If You Can’t See it, It’s Not There. Fact: Mold frequently grows in inaccessible, obscured spaces such as inside drywall, under flooring, within wall cavities, or inside HVAC ductwork. A persistent musty odor is a strong warning of hidden mold, necessitating a professional inspection and testing.
  • Myth: Killing Mold is Enough. Fact: Killing mold does not neutralize its allergenic or dangerous properties. Dead mold spores can still initiate allergic reactions and respiratory issues. Effective mold remediation regularly involves the complete removal of the mold and its spores, not just their eradication.
  • Myth: A Fan Will Dry Out Moldy Areas Quickly. Fact: While fans assist in evaporation, using them in a mold-affected area without proper containment can easily propagate mold spores to other, previously unaffected parts of the property, intensifying the problem significantly.

  • Our Comprehensive Mold Testing Methods: Our certified mold inspectors employ a range of technically advanced and scientifically validated methods:

    • Initial Visual Inspection (Keyword: mold inspection Munford, Tennessee): Every testing process begins with a detailed visual inspection of the entire property within Munford, Tennessee. This involves a careful search for visible mold growth, signs of past or present water intrusion, water staining, musty odors, and conditions that often promote mold growth (e.g., poor ventilation, high humidity). We meticulously examine vulnerable areas including basements, attics, crawl spaces, behind appliances, and within HVAC systems.
    • Air Sampling (Keyword: indoor air quality testing for mold Munford, Tennessee): This highly effective method helps identify airborne mold spores, even if the source is hidden. We use specialized equipment (e.g., spore traps or viable bioaerosol samplers) to precisely collect air samples from various locations inside your property and from outdoor control areas. These samples are then analyzed by accredited laboratories to determine airborne spore types and their concentrations. This data is critical for understanding the overall indoor air quality profile and detecting hidden mold.
    • Surface Sampling: When visible or suspicious growth is detected on a surface, we collect targeted samples using tape lifts or swabs. These samples are analyzed by a laboratory to precisely identify the mold species and confirm if the mold is actively growing on that particular surface. This guides targeted cleaning protocols.
    • Bulk Sampling: For deeper analysis or when mold has penetrated extensively into building materials, bulk samples (small pieces of the affected material) may be collected. This provides in-depth information about the mold's growth characteristics and colonization.
    • Moisture Assessment (Keyword: moisture mapping Munford, Tennessee): Crucial for finding the root cause. We use non-invasive moisture meters (capacitance type) to detect moisture levels behind surfaces without damage, followed by pin-type penetrative meters where appropriate. This allows us to meticulously "map" moisture migration patterns and pinpoint the exact source of water causing the mold.
    • Environmental Data Collection: Temperature and humidity readings are recorded throughout the property. This data helps us understand the environmental conditions conducive to mold growth in Munford, Tennessee and inform preventative strategies.

  • Independent Laboratory Analysis: All collected samples are instantly dispatched to independent, third-party, AIHA-accredited laboratories. These external labs provide neutral, scientifically rigorous results, ensuring the reliability and trustworthiness of our findings. This critical step provides objective data that forms the basis of all subsequent recommendations.

  • Our Proven 7-Step Remediation Process: Designed for thorough and lasting and enduring outcomes:

    1. Property Evaluation (Post-Testing): We examine the detailed mold testing results to confirm the scope of activity and formulate a precise plan, locating affected areas and access points.
    2. Personalized Remediation Plan: A specific, tailored plan is designed based on the mold type, extent of contamination, affected materials, and your Munford, Tennessee propertys unique structure. This plan emphasizes occupant safety and effective mold removal.
    3. Containment (Keyword: mold remediation process Munford, Tennessee): We create industrial-grade containment zones using polyethylene sheeting, creating physical barriers around affected areas. Industrial negative air pressure machines and HEPA-filtered air scrubbers are deployed to prevent any mold spores from becoming airborne and contaminating to unaffected areas during the remediation process.
    4. Air Purification: Throughout the remediation, these HEPA-filtered air scrubbers continuously purify the air, clearing airborne mold spores, dust, and other contaminants, creating a safer work environment and boosting overall indoor air quality.
    5. Safe Mold Removal and Cleaning (Keyword: mold remediation services Munford, Tennessee): Our certified technicians, wearing full personal protective equipment (PPE), thoroughly remove all mold-infested materials. Porous materials like drywall, insulation, and carpeting that cannot be effectively decontaminated are safely removed and disposed of. Non-porous surfaces are treated, cleaned, and cleaned using EPA-approved antimicrobial solutions. Special attention is given to black mold removal in Munford, Tennessee, following enhanced safety protocols due to the potential presence of mycotoxins.
    6. Moisture Removal and Drying (Keyword: mold prevention Munford, Tennessee): After all mold is physically removed, the affected areas are thoroughly dried and dehumidified using industrial-grade air movers and commercial dehumidifiers. Moisture levels in all building materials are tracked to ensure they meet industry dry standards, eliminating the conditions necessary for mold regrowth.
    7. Final Restoration and Cleanup: Once completely dry, the areas are cleaned of any remaining debris. We then undertake necessary restoration work, which can include small repairs or partnering with trusted partners for larger reconstruction, restoring your Munford, Tennessee property to its pre-loss condition, mold-free and ready for re-occupancy after final clearance testing.

Long-Term Mold Prevention and Maintenance in Munford, Tennessee

At Mold Test America, our focus extends well beyond remediation. We empower Munford, Tennessee property owners with forward-thinking approaches and essential measures to thoroughly eliminate mold recurrence, ensuring a long-term healthy indoor environment.

  • Integrated Moisture Management: Our approach carefully assesses your property's entire moisture envelope. This is not merely about patching a leak; it's a all-encompassing examination of how water interacts with your structure. We inspect exterior grading, check gutter functionality, inspect downspout efficacy, and examine the overall structural integrity of your Munford, Tennessee property, all to ensure that water is properly redirected away from your foundation.
  • Advanced Ventilation Solutions: Proper air circulation is a critical, yet frequently underestimated, element of mold prevention. We thoroughly evaluate existing ventilation systems in typically moisture-prone areas (bathrooms, kitchens, laundry rooms, basements, and attics) to confirm they are efficiently removing moist air. Our recommendations may include installing high-efficiency exhaust fans, adding passive ventilation, or upgrading existing HVAC systems to ensure balanced air exchange, thereby significantly reducing humidity and preventing condensation.
  • Targeted Dehumidification Systems: For properties in Munford, Tennessee that deal with chronically elevated indoor humidity, we offer advanced dehumidification solutions. These far surpass standard retail units, featuring whole-home systems integrated with your HVAC or tailored standalone units for basements and crawl spaces, engineered to maintain optimal indoor humidity levels (ideally 30-50%).
  • Mold-Resistant Building Materials: When restorations are needed post-remediation, we help our clients in picking and utilizing state-of-the-art mold-resistant building materials. This includes advanced drywall, paints with embedded mold inhibitors, cellulose-free insulation, and moisture-resistant flooring options. This strategic material choice greatly minimizes the potential for future mold infestation.
  • Ongoing Monitoring and Maintenance Plans: For clients seeking long-term peace of mind, we offer tailored maintenance plans. These can include periodic moisture checks, frequent humidity monitoring, re-inspection of at-risk areas, and proactive adjustments to waterproofing or ventilation systems. This preventative service ensures that initial issues are recognized and expertly addressed before they can escalate into significant mold problems, offering lasting protection for your investment in Munford, Tennessee.
